Vice President JD Vance to Visit Minneapolis This Week
Vice President JD Vance will meet local leaders and ICE agents in Minneapolis to highlight the administration's support for immigration enforcement amid ongoing community tensions.
- On Thursday, Vice President JD Vance will visit Minneapolis, Minnesota to deliver remarks, hold a roundtable with local leaders and community members, and meet privately with Immigration and Customs Enforcement agents.
- After the fatal shooting of Renee Nicole Good, 37, local tensions have increased, with federal prosecutors serving subpoenas to Gov. Tim Walz, Minneapolis Mayor Jacob Frey, and others Tuesday.
- At a Jan. 8, 2026 White House briefing, Vice President JD Vance defended ICE actions, claiming federal officers have broad protections and announced new fraud-focused DOJ roles.
- Minneapolis officials are responding with actions, including a January 21st, 2026 ordinance to limit federal enforcement staging and Jason Chavez warning, `There’s definitely an uptick compared to the last few days`.
- Observers note the visit coincides with intensifying fraud and legal probes that highlight the White House's focus on Minnesota as a political target amid alleged fraud investigations linked to $19 billion and DOJ subpoenas.
